There is a Dutch kid that lives in Australia, he flew over to America bought a 500 KTM in San Diego. He got on the Bike road it all the way to La Paz with the intention of entering the Baja 1000. He needed a fuel brake (I don’t even know what that is?). A gps tracker and they said he needed new tires.. scrounged it all up and entered and ran a large portion of the race in 2nd place!!
He stopped at some random pit and they gave him some water and tacos and he was off again. Stopped at another random pit with a bent rim and they zip tied the front tire to the rim and he’s about 50 miles out from finishing right now.. I’m not sure what place he is in but I think it’s still top ten.
To iron man this race is crazy.. even finishing is an accomplishment. This kid is doing pretty well with zero pre running, zero support, just him a backpack (which I’m presuming has his clothes and his passport in it?) and a ktm 500.
